# NOTE for new contractors:
# We're migrating the old cron jobs into Loomflow, our workflow engine,
# one schedule at a time. This client talks to the internal Loomflow
# scheduler API to register job definitions. Don't touch the legacy
# crontab on the batch host — it still runs the unported jobs and will
# be retired later. The client constructor expects an API key for the
# scheduler service, which is provided below.

app token of bahaf-tajeg = zpat23_SjjsllwiLmXbtS65veZaV47

Step 7 — FlagWeave rollout framework key ceremony. Confirm both signing custodians are present in the Larkvale secure room before opening the escrow envelope. Verify the hardware token serial against the ceremony log, then initialize the FlagWeave signing key used to authorize feature-flag rollout bundles. As the new contractor, you only witness and countersign; do not touch the token. Record the time, then read out the recovery passphrase printed below.

unlock words, yawig-kagef: gordor-holvan-ulaael-pramir-ulaiel-tamdor

## Environment Variables: Tenant Quotas (Fennelgate)

For this week's sync: Fennelgate now enforces per-tenant rate quotas at the edge rather than in the worker pool. Configure `TENANT_QUOTA_DEFAULT` (requests/minute) and `TENANT_QUOTA_BURST` carefully — values are read once at boot, so changes require a rolling restart. Overrides per tenant live in the quota table, not the env file. Finally, the quota reporter must authenticate to the metering backend, which requires this entry:

sealed setting: RELAY_SECRET13=bca49b02a6971

Briefing — Leadership Review: Annual Billing Transition

Vexora Systems proposes migrating all Cloudline subscriptions from monthly to annual billing effective next fiscal year. Modeling by the Finance team in Harleth shows improved cash predictability and a projected 4% reduction in churn-related revenue loss. Discounting tiers, proration rules, and migration timing remain under evaluation. The confidential note below outlines the strategic rationale for leadership only.

internal memo for kawip-hadug: Headcount on the Wenwyn team goes from 7 to 140 by the end of January. Gross margin on Wenwyn came in at 20 percent against a plan of 15 percent.